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
043791 1372468 2771507 7210871557
150385 1295 213038
150385 1295 213038
7496 3392 29901 709081 23323416500
All about undefined
Interested in learning more?
150385 1295 213038
7496 3392 29901 709081 23323416500
See more
0011 33
017 0752859 158862
See more
6101021 0105
5442 0726 433 019
See more